Richard Ríos and Enzo Barrenechea may soon face competition at Benfica. According to the latest information, the Eagles are considering the possibility of signing a midfielder in the January transfer window, even though it is not José Mourinho’s squad’s top priority for the winter break.
“The Reds are evaluating the signing of a central midfielder, although it is not a priority. Benfica has already made a significant investment in signing Richard Ríos from Palmeiras and Enzo Barrenechea,” writes the newspaper Record in its Tuesday, November 11 edition, reporting on the club’s plans.
Enzo Barrenechea and Richard Ríos have been key players for Benfica this season. Between Bruno Lage and José Mourinho, the 24-year-old Argentine and the 25-year-old Colombian are the fifth and sixth most-used players so far, with 1,736 and 1,723 minutes played respectively in the Sacred Mantle.
Despite their heavy usage, the significant investment Benfica made in Enzo Barrenechea and Richard Ríos has led some fans to demand more from the players. The former Aston Villa player will cost 15 million euros (3 million for the loan fee, plus 12 million for the permanent transfer), while the former Palmeiras player required the Eagles to shell out 27 million euros.
